Ticket: StormFan alert fan-out stalled — vault locked.

The Cirrocast weather-alert fan-out can't fetch signing keys; the Keeva vault auto-locked after three failed node attestations. Alerts are queuing, nothing dropped yet, but county-level severe notices are delayed ~4 min and climbing. Restarting the fan-out workers won't help until the vault opens. Unseal from the ops console on bastion-2, then requeue the backlog. The vault unseal requires the recovery passphrase, provided below.

recovery phrase for bawep-kawef: oliath-casdor

Welcome to reviewing the Quillmark media pipeline. Every image that lands in our uploader passes through ScrubJet, our EXIF-stripping service, before anything touches the CDN. When reviewing PRs, confirm that no code path bypasses ScrubJet — GPS tags and serial numbers must never survive to storage. The service authenticates to the stripping queue with a shared credential kept in the local env file, never in source. For a working review sandbox, add the following line to your .env before running the suite.

sealed setting: RELAY_SECRET29=2d90f50448baa6c07af134de232e6

## Key Ceremony Checklist — Item 7 (Dedup Pipeline)

Before the Quillmere dedup job merges customer records across regions, the signing key protecting merge audit logs must be re-sealed. Release manager confirms both custodians are present, the ceremony room is cleared, and the previous shard set is destroyed. Once the new shards are distributed, verify the vault accepts the recovery passphrase recorded below.

strongbox words: sorir-belvan-rusix-ulays-ralmir-praix-eliir-tamax-praael-druael-julir-tamius-jorir